    Hey Simon, love your videos. What area of shoals do you fish as I find it hard to catch a fish whenever I go there. I always thought it was flat and didn’t even know there were any bommies there.

    • @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220
      @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220 Місяць тому

      Hey mate , I’m fishing about 5km past the shallow part of the shoals in around 16-18m of water. There’s a bunch of ground out that way. Not huge bommies, mostly just rubbly ground. I have other spots a few more km’s out too . It’s still on the shoals platform, sort of half way between rock cod and tullarook but a bit further out . Just sound around out that way and you will find plenty of ground.

    • @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220
      @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220 2 роки тому

      Having a dc reel is the big advantage though. You don’t get those mid cast over runs casting light lures. Put the cast controller on 2 and cast it as hard as you can. They take a thousand readings a second when cast to control the speed the reel is spinning to the speed the lure is traveling at You will never buy another bait cast reel again. They are the best on the market at a very fair price

    Hey Simon, have you thought about putting a watersnake electric motor on it? I have the same yak, but would be interested on your thoughts of whether an electric could be mounted in the rudder hold or where the pedal drive drops in..?

    • @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220
      @yaksjackswithsimonpimm5220 2 роки тому

      I haven’t on this kayak . My old Jackson kayak used to have an electric motor but I have gone away from them. (It’s in my older videos)The only real advantage of the electric motor over pedal power is the traveling to the fishing destination. Once you’re at your destination you have much more control with the pedal drive . Another disadvantage is having a big , really heavy battery on board. I was only getting about 4-5 hours out of a 70ah battery so I bought a 100ah battery to get through a fishing trip. They are soooo heavy and I’d imagine it would also make a “sit on top” kayak quite unstable, and it would be pretty much impossible to fit a big battery in the hull to make it more stable. My old kayak was a “sit in” so the battery didn’t affect the stability, just my back, lifting the bloody thing in and out. The electric was only pushing it at 6kph and I can go all day with the pedal drive at 5kph so there isn’t much difference there. But if you want to give it a go, go for it! The biggest problem is getting a battery big enough for your needs and getting it to fit as low in the kayak as possible. Let me know how you go if you give it a try
